12 New Forest Fires

Despite the rain, the fire hazard is heating up across Northwestern
Ontario, primarily in the Fort Frances and Thunder Bay Districts.
12-new forest fires were reported in the Region Thursday.
11-were lightning caused, while the other is under investigation.
All of the new fires were under 1-hectare in size and were
extinguished by firerangers and water bombers.
